Introduction

Shell has recently taken a significant step forward in the global energy landscape with its Final Investment Decision (FID) for an LNG regasification terminal in The Bahamas. This project is not just about expanding Shell's operations; it symbolizes a crucial evolution in the Caribbean's energy infrastructure, aiming to enhance energy security and meet rising demand in an increasingly competitive market.

The Bahamas: A Strategic Location for Energy Development

The Bahamas sits at a strategic junction for energy transport, making it an attractive location for LNG regasification projects. With the global shift toward cleaner energy sources, Shell's investment signals a commitment to transitioning the region's energy profile.

The Economic Impact

This regasification terminal is expected to deliver multiple economic benefits. By investing hundreds of millions of dollars in the local economy, Shell aims to create jobs, support local businesses, and boost the overall economic resilience of The Bahamas. Moreover, this project will facilitate access to natural gas, which is crucial for both residential and industrial uses.
